Angular Libraries. location.historyGo(2) moves forward two pages and location.historyGo(-2) moves back two pages. In the closed state, the navigation menu is partially visible because it displays item icons. JS Modules vs Is cycling an aerobic or anaerobic exercise? @mhisham, sorry, already don't remember, it was a while ago :). Workspace configuration. Angular is a platform for building mobile and desktop web applications. How to use google Transliterate in angular 6? A negative value moves backwards, a positive value moves forwards, e.g. All those solutions are not 100% clean and this is probably something that is worth to make a feature request for that as it currently does not have a real native solution for that. Workspace and project structure. JS Modules vs This link will take you tothe Overview page. Replacing outdoor electrical box at end of conduit. npm dependencies. NgModules. How to draw a grid of grids-with-polygons? To learn more, see our tips on writing great answers. NgModules introduction. And then simply importing it in the component as property. This link will take you tothe Overview page. The button's click handler passes the value to the component's callPhone() method. NgModules. TypeScript configuration. Workspace configuration. Workspace configuration. TypeScript configuration. Building a template-driven form. In the previous example, phone refers to the phone number . Workspace configuration. But let me tell you that Angular is completely different from AngularJS.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. You don't have to declare the enum in the same file as the component. The application includes two layouts. In most cases, Angular sets the template variable's value to the element on which it occurs. Template statements are methods or properties that you can use in your HTML to respond to user events. To add a custom toolbar item, open the header.component.html file in this directory and add a dxi-item element inside dx-toolbar. A menu item should either navigate to a page OR include subitems. Angular is a platform for building mobile and desktop web applications. 2022 Moderator Election Q&A Question Collection, How to access variables of one component in another component [Angular], Use variable of one component in another component in the same file. When applied to an element in a template, makes that element a link that initiates navigation to a route. Project file structure. Project file structure. I want to use "message" variable of parent component in a child component. The button's click handler passes the value to the component's callPhone() method. Template variables. Libraries overview. Workspace and project structure. The app.component.ts and app.component.spec.ts files are siblings in the same folder. Project file structure. Connect and share knowledge within a single location that is structured and easy to search. Update these functions to make actual requests to your back end. You don't need to set up your local You can use its getUser() method to access this information: To generate an application without views and a navigation menu, use the --empty flag: Copyright 2011-2022 Developer Express Inc.
Angular is a platform for building mobile and desktop web applications. npm dependencies. Do not rely on client-side routing to protect your application from unauthorized access. Project file structure. Libraries overview. I want to use "message" variable of parent component in a child component. It's not recommended to use getters though.They cost a lot of performance. Angular is a platform for building mobile and desktop web applications. ngFor and ng-template. I use this for Enums because they look cleaner in the code. Project file structure. The ng-template directive and the related ngTemplateOutlet directive are very powerful Angular features that support a wide TypeScript configuration. TypeScript configuration. ; Creating a componentlink. Extend the HTML vocabulary of your applications With special Angular syntax in your templates. Angular's template reference variables provide a useful API through which you can interact with DOM elements and child components directly in your Angular code. Such template variables can be used in conjunction with ngTemplateOutlet directives to render the content defined inside tags. When we try to go beyond what's stored in the history session, we stay in the current page. NgModules. Angular is a platform for building mobile and desktop web applications. NgModules. ; Creating a componentlink. Each item configuration can have the following fields: path - a navigation path associated with the item. npm dependencies. Project file structure. JS Modules vs Setting up NgOptimizedImage. The Template reference variable is a reference to any DOM element, component or a directive in the Template. In the template type-checking phase, the Angular template compiler uses the TypeScript compiler to validate the binding expressions in templates. The best way to create a component is Workspace and project structure. Workspace configuration. Template variables. Angular is a platform for building mobile and desktop web applications. Apply that to without the square brackets. Using NgForm with template variableslink. For example, if I have three components which make different tables, and I want to make unique component which render pagination numbers. Project file structure. I would avoid calling a function to return the enum because it will be called on every re-render and will impact your performance if this is heavily used. Prerequisiteslink. Share information across HTML elements using template reference variables; Prerequisiteslink. Angular is a TypeScript-based open-source front-end web application platform led by the Angular Team at Google and by a community of individuals and corporations. Why is SQL Server setup recommending MAXDOP 8 here? Template variables. this.loginauth.validateUser(name,pass); loginauth was the service and validateUser() method inside it. We can add custom animations, directives, and services. Angular is a TypeScript-based open-source front-end web application platform led by the Angular Team at Google and by a community of individuals and corporations. Stack Overflow for Teams is moving to its own domain! npm dependencies. The following code adds a search button to the toolbar: In the code above, the button click handler is declared in the SideNavOuterToolbarComponent. Template variables. If the application uses the inner toolbar layout, add the same code to the SideNavInnerToolbarComponent. Template variables. For that reason, do not specify both. The event handling process is seamless. The element is where you apply the directive you just made. Converting Dirac Notation to Coordinate Space, SQL PostgreSQL add attribute from polygon to all points inside polygon but keep all points not just those that fall inside polygon. Angular is a platform for building mobile and desktop web applications. You can use constructor. npm dependencies. Not the answer you're looking for? When applied to an element in a template, makes that element a link that initiates navigation to a route. When we try to go beyond what's stored in the history session, we stay in the current page. This command also creates a navigation menu item for the added view in the src\app\app-navigation.ts file. You can define different named build configurations for your project, such as staging and production, with different defaults.. Each named configuration can have defaults for any of the options that apply to the various builder targets, such as build, All trademarks or registered trademarks are property of their respective owners. Workspace and project structure. Project file structure. And call it in the child component.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Workspace and project structure. Template variables. Workspace and project structure. For example, Angular helps you get and set DOM (Document Object Model) values dynamically with features such as built-in template functions, variables, event listening, and data binding. Angular is a platform for building mobile and desktop web applications. Try Angular without local setup. JS Modules vs Project file structure. This guide describes Angular Universal, a technology that renders Angular applications on the server.. A normal Angular application executes in the browser, rendering pages in the DOM in response to user actions.Angular Universal executes on the server, generating static application pages that later get bootstrapped on the client. If you don't have a project, create one using ng new , where is the name of your Angular application. Angular Webpack Starter . Template variables. This page discusses build-specific configuration options for Angular projects. Angular is a platform for building mobile and desktop web applications. Angular is a TypeScript-based open-source front-end web application platform led by the Angular Team at Google and by a community of individuals and corporations. NgModules. I wanted to use "loginStatus" in headerComponent. Theme variables are defined in the src\themes\generated\variables.base.scss and src\themes\generated\variables.additional.scss files. Workspace configuration. If you plan to use this enum in many components, I suggest you use a Pipe: And then use it in any template like this: Thanks for contributing an answer to Stack Overflow! The generated application already contains the DataGrid and Form components. Template variables. The event handling process is seamless. uib-accordion settings. We can also use #variable=exportAsName when the component/directive defines an exportAs metadata. Basic modelink. Which "href" value should I use for JavaScript links, "#" or "javascript:void(0)"? NgModules introduction. To apply the AdDirective, recall the selector from ad.directive.ts, [adHost]. How do I simplify/combine these two methods for finding the smallest and largest int in an array? TypeScript and HTML5 programming; Angular application-design fundamentals, as described in Angular Concepts; The basics of Angular template syntax Client-side routing is configured so that unauthenticated users can navigate to authentication pages only. Building a template-driven form. NgModules introduction. It also provides us with more power than the element gives us by default, seamlessly fitting into the way Angular compiles our code. In the previous example, phone refers to the phone number . Is it possible to leave a research position in the middle of a project gracefully and without burning bridges? Workspace and project structure. npm dependencies. Should we burninate the [variations] tag? In the most basic type-checking mode, with the fullTemplateTypeCheck flag set to false, Angular validates only top-level expressions in a template. This means that rev2022.11.3.43005. Workspace and project structure. This component is applied when the outer toolbar layout is used. Template variables. We can also use #variable=exportAsName when the component/directive defines an exportAs metadata. Create an Angular workspace with initial application. We can add custom animations, directives, and services. Try Angular without local setup. Workspace and project structure. rev2022.11.3.43005. Prerequisiteslink. An Angular starter kit featuring Angular 6, Ahead of Time Compile, Router, Forms, Http, Services, Tests, E2E), Karma, Protractor, Jasmine, Istanbul, TypeScript, @types, TsLint, Codelyzer, Hot Module Replacement, and Webpack.. Add Enum reference to the component ts file like below, then you will be able to use the reference in your template like this, This has some value. The event handling process is seamless. Create an Angular workspace with initial application. How can I solve it? Template variables. What's a good single chain ring size for a 7s 12-28 cassette for better hill climbing? Template variables. Share information across HTML elements using template reference variables; Prerequisiteslink. NgModules. Template variables. Workspace configuration. Like your answer. Template variables. How to use a variable from a component in another in Angular2, angular.io/docs/ts/latest/cookbook/component-communication.html,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. Almost all HTML syntax is valid template syntax. The element is where you apply the directive you just made.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Not the answer you're looking for? Project file structure. npm dependencies. ngFor and ng-template. The only difference between them is where the toolbar is located. Project file structure. In this post, we are going to dive into some of the more advanced features of Angular Core!. Extend the HTML vocabulary of your applications With special Angular syntax in your templates. Workspace configuration. But let me tell you that Angular is completely different from AngularJS. Follow the steps below: Import src\themes\metadata.base.json or src\themes\metadata.additional.json to the ThemeBuilder. Workspace and project structure. Template variables. The root file names (app.component) are the same for both files.Adopt these two conventions in your own projects for every kind of test file.. Place your spec file next to the file it testslink. Workspace configuration. Fourier transform of a functional derivative, Can i pour Kwikcrete into a 4" round aluminum legs to add support to a gazebo. Project file structure. TypeScript configuration. So the getter function runs every time Angular performs Change Detection.Now, I'm not saying that just running this function will cost performance. Workspace and project structure. NgModules introduction. This guide describes Angular Universal, a technology that renders Angular applications on the server.. A normal Angular application executes in the browser, rendering pages in the DOM in response to user actions.Angular Universal executes on the server, generating static application pages that later get bootstrapped on the client. If you are new to Angular, you might want to start with Try it now!, which introduces the essentials of Angular in the context of a ready-made basic online store app for you to examine and modify.This standalone tutorial takes advantage of the interactive StackBlitz environment for online development. An Angular starter kit featuring Angular 6, Ahead of Time Compile, Router, Forms, Http, Services, Tests, E2E), Karma, Protractor, Jasmine, Istanbul, TypeScript, @types, TsLint, Codelyzer, Hot Module Replacement, and Webpack.. Workspace configuration. We can add custom animations, directives, and services. Workspace and project structure. If the items do not have icons, you can hide the menu. If you're looking for Angular 1.x please use NG6-starter If you're looking to learn Stub authentication functions for back-end requests are implemented in the AuthService. LO Writer: Easiest way to put line of words into table as rows (list). Workspace configuration. To keep things simple in this example, the HTML is in the @Component decorator's template property as a template string. NgModules. Basic modelink. How can I set the default value for an HTML